That being said, a cake mix can also become brownies. How, you ask? Well I'm glad you asked!

Brownies are basically just richer, fudgier cake, right? So a simple chocolate cake mix (or devils food cake mix, or dark chocolate cake mix - you get the idea) can easily become brownies.

Ingredients:
1 box chocolate cake mix
1/4 cup vegetable oil
1/3 cup milk
1 egg
Extra chocolate

So basically mix together, bake about 20 minutes at about 350 degrees. I say about, because of course that changes based on the size of your pan, the added chocolate, etc.

I added chocolate chips AND white chocolate chips, and ended up with triple-chocolate brownies that were to die for. Not even kidding.
